Pros

- Everywhere: post offices and processing centers are all over the country, so there's lots of flexibility for transfers - Huge organization - Careers in every field: the postal service has career options in everything from engineering or maintenance to writing or social media - Lots of training opportunities like six sigma, AutoCAD, or programming

Cons

- Tenured employees hoard information and are very hesitant to train or help their peers - Huge "us vs them" culture between craft and EAS employees - Plant leadership (at most processing sites) is aggressive and argumentative - Young engineers are often ignored and disrespected - Lots of finger pointing and not enough teamwork - The overall culture is abrasive and unsupportive
